Game 1 Feb 22: Skyline hit 28 of 36 free throws (78 percent), including 11 of 13 in the fourth quarter. The Spartans trailed by five going into the final period. The teams combined for 38 fouls and 48 free throws. Samantha Angel got 12 of her team-high 19 points in the fourth quarter for Skyline (11-9). Jordan Pelluer scored 14 and Madison Maloney 13 for the Spartans. Redmond (11-10) wasted a season-best 31 points and 14 rebounds by senior Erika Edwards

Game 2 Feb 25: At Juanita, Ballard regained its composure after blowing a 13-point first-half lead, and held on to beat Redmond in a KingCo 4A district loser-out game Saturday at Juanita High School. A pair of 6-foot senior posts, Gillian Huggins and Charlotte Shannon, combined for 28 points to lead the Beavers (12-10). Ballard advances to play Roosevelt on Tuesday. With Redmond senior star Erika Edwards hampered by foul trouble, Lina Perugini had 14 points and Katie Kruger had eight points and nine rebounds for the Mustangs (11-11).
